有反应的项目,生产和开发在哪里。虚拟服务器上的项目已在生产中启动。任务是使用与虚拟服务器不同的环境运行该项目的另一个版本。问题是您不能指定.env.prodaction文件的多个版本。我试图运行开发-TeamCity挂起,试图直接在teamCity中更改生产环境变量-也无法正常工作。 我在虚拟服务器上运行的一组命令:
答案 0 :(得分:0)
找到解决方案。我创建了一个.env.staging文件,并将新脚本添加到我的package.json中。
{
"scripts": {
"build:staging": "env-cmd -f .env.staging npm run build"
}
}